The murderer who has been convicted finds God and confesses to lie about Duke Lacros Rape Scandal -religious wires

Not a murderer who has been convicted of a former stripper, but a desire for verification from people, not God, admits that all the scandals that shaked the country nearly 20 years ago were lies. Ta.

After accusing the members of the Duke University Lacrosse Team with rape and invitation N, Crystal Magnum, a student at Chuo University, a former North Carolina, which attracted international attention in 2006, has recently been Crystal Magnum I acknowledged that the entire cloth was created with the appearance of a podcast.

For several years since the manufactured scandal broke out, Magnum killed her boyfriend resinald day with a kitchen knife because she accused David Evans, Colin Finnati, and a brutal crime of lead Seligman. I was guilty of what I did. She was sentenced to a minimum of 14 years behind the bar for murder in 2011.

She endured the lie that she passed away in the interview with Caterana Depascale’s podcast “Let’s Talk to Cat”.

Magnum continued. “They are my siblings, they trusted me -I wouldn’t betray their trust -I said they rape me when they didn’t. On the other hand, it was wrong.

The radioactive drops from the rape claims were deep and wide, and then seriously destroyed.

At that time, Evans told the CBS News Magnum: She is holding it. She destroyed the other two families and shame the great university. And the worst thing is that she has just divided the community and the nation to the facts that have never happened and the lies that have never been said. “

“Your life you are trying to do is trying to do the right way you know and do the right way,” said Seligman. “And someone can come together and take it all. By doing so, just turn your finger. That is all.”

In addition to claiming that she was sexually assaulted, Magnum accidentally blamed her to suffer her with racial praise.

That alone, the President Richard Brodhead at the time has launched a series of committees and a series of committees, who will ultimately pause this year’s Lacrosse team.

As the holes in the story of the Magnum grow, Democratic Party Loy Cooper Ceremony Roy Cooper said in 2007, “these incidents were the result of not verifying the tragic rush and serious claims.” Was announced.

“Based on an important contradiction between the evidence and the blame, we believe that these three individuals are innocent about these accusations,” he said. 。 “We approached this case with the understanding that rape and sexual assault victims often have some contradictions in the explanation of trauma -like events. But in this case, the contradiction is very important. It was contrary to evidence that there was no reliable evidence that an attack occurred in the house that night. “

A man who was accidentally accused by terrible actions later appealed to Duke University and a blod head with a private amount. Mike Niffon, a Democratic member of the Dalam County at the time, was intentionally withheld from athlete lawyers, lied to the court, and misleading the players. After that, I resigned.

Magnum had never been charged with her catastrophic lie, but she is now seeking her false reconciliation.

“I believed in me and wanted to verify from God, not from God, so I betrayed the trust of many other people who created a non -true story,” she said. “It was wrong. God already loved me for who I was.”

“I hurt my brothers,” Magnum added in a conversation with Depas Clear. “I hope they can forgive me, and I want them to know that I love them, and they didn’t deserve it.”

When the pod caster first reached out to Magnum, the murderer who was convicted regretted.

She said from a correction facility for women in North Carolina, “I lied to my family, my friend, and the god about it,” I actually lied about this case.
